DNS的工作原理
DNS是一个分布式、层次化的数据库系统,由遍布全球的多台DNS服务器共同构成,当用户在浏览器中输入一个域名时,查询过程首先是从本地DNS服务器开始,若本地服务器无对应记录则会向上级服务器查询,直至找到正确的IP地址,这个过程确保了全球范围内域名解析的高效和准确。
DNS的关键角色
1、域名与IP映射
简化网络访问:用户通过易于记忆的域名访问网站,而非复杂的IP地址。
维护更新映射:DNS数据库不断更新,反映域名与IP间的变动,保持访问的正确性。
快速响应请求:DNS通过分布式结构实现快速的域名解析,优化用户体验。
2、负载均衡与高可用性
分散访问压力:通过将请求分配至不同的服务器,避免单点过载,提升网站稳定性。
增强服务可用性:在服务器故障时,DNS能将访问导向其他正常服务器,确保服务的连续性。
本地缓存机制:减少对外部DNS服务器的依赖,提高解析速度和降低响应时间。
3、内容过滤与访问控制
屏蔽不良内容:通过配置DNS服务器,可以阻止对某些不适宜或危险网站的访问。
家长控制功能:允许家长通过DNS设置限制儿童访问特定类型的网络内容。
提升网络安全:正确配置的DNS可以防止中间人攻击和DNS劫持,保护用户信息安全。
备用DNS的重要性
1、提高网络连通性
提供备份解析路径:当主DNS出现问题时,备用DNS立即接管,保证网络的连续可用。
防止单点故障:备用DNS的加入,避免了因主DNS故障导致的全网中断风险。
2、增强网络安全
防止DNS劫持:多个DNS服务器分布可降低被单一攻击全部瘫痪的风险。
避免DNS污染:备用DNS可提供正确信息,抵御返回错误或伪造信息的污染攻击。
DNS的其他应用
1、邮件系统中的应用
邮件交换记录解析:DNS中的MX记录指明邮件服务器地址,确保邮件正确投递。
防止垃圾邮件:正确配置的DNS可以帮助识别和过滤来自未授权服务器的垃圾邮件。
2、在企业网络中的应用
内部域名解析:企业可通过内部DNS解析内部服务器名称,便于员工访问内部资源。
IT管理简化:通过DNS,IT部门能更方便地管理企业内部的网站访问规则和策略。
DNS作为互联网基础设施的重要组成部分,不仅实现了域名与IP地址之间的映射,还在负载均衡、高可用性、内容过滤及网络安全等方面发挥着关键作用,备用DNS的设立进一步增强了网络的稳定性和安全性,对于任何使用互联网的个人和企业而言,理解并合理利用DNS是保障网络通畅和安全的重要步骤。
相关问题与解答
1、如何检查DNS服务器是否正常工作?
答:可以通过在命令行中使用ping
命令加上域名来测试是否能够连接到该域名对应的服务器,如果无法解析域名,可能是DNS服务器存在问题。
2、DNS劫持是什么?
答:DNS劫持是一种网络攻击,黑客通过篡改DNS服务器的响应,将用户重定向到错误的IP地址,通常用于钓鱼或分发恶意软件。
来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/36162.html